Highway Patrol veteran fired after charge filed

Published: July 5, 2009

The N.C. Highway Patrol has fired a local trooper who was arrested on a charge of driving while impaired after he sideswiped an SUV in Clemmons while he was off duty Thursday, patrol officials said in a news release.
Sgt. Crawford David Jones, 48, of 186 Hickory Tree Road, Mocksville, was traveling north on Lewisville-Clemmons Road at 9:21 p.m. when he hit the SUV.
Troopers investigating the incident registered his blood-alcohol content at 0.22 percent, patrol officials said. The legal limit is 0.08 percent.
Jones joined the Highway Patrol in December 1985.
The incident is still under investigation, Highway Patrol officials said.
